数据结构 - 栈和队列 介绍 栈和队列是两种很简单, 但也很重要的数据结构, 在之后的内容也会用到的 栈的特点就是FILO(first in last out) 而队列则是FIFO(first in first out) 栈和队列也是列表 栈和队列都可以认为是链表, 只是插入删除的方式做了改变 栈的 ...
分类:
其他好文 时间:
2018-12-07 12:00:34
阅读次数:
177
about 算法 项目介绍 工作之余,代码敲多了,停下来思考思考,会有异常不到的收获。。。只为更好的自己 如何用栈实现队列? 提示下:用一个栈肯定是没办法实现队列,但如果我们有两个栈呢? 分析:栈和队列的特性 栈是先进后出,FILO 出入元素都是在同一端(栈顶) 入栈 1540432924606.p ...
分类:
其他好文 时间:
2018-11-08 01:11:05
阅读次数:
163
这一类问题要考察的核心其实是元素进出栈、队列的规则。 拿栈来说,元素进出的顺序是相反的,先进后出,FILO。运用这个特性,我们可以把一个栈的全部元素逆序移至另一个栈。 举例来说,有一组元素排成序列abcd,保存在栈X中,其中d为栈顶元素,a为栈底元素。另外还有一个栈Y,是空的。当我们把序列中的元素逐 ...
分类:
其他好文 时间:
2018-09-22 18:16:35
阅读次数:
162
队列 from multiprocessing import Queue 队列: 先进先出(First In First Out 简称 FIFO)/// 栈:先进后出(First In Last Out 简称 FILO) Queue 方法介绍 : 其他方法: 进程间通信的队列 生产者消费者模型 主要 ...
分类:
编程语言 时间:
2018-08-23 19:37:00
阅读次数:
158
1.生产者消费者模型 主要是为解耦 借助队列来实现生产者消费这模型 栈:先进后出(First In Last Out 简称:FILO) 队列:先进先出(FIFO) import queue from multiprocessing import Queue 借助Queue解决生产者消费这模型队列是安 ...
分类:
编程语言 时间:
2018-08-22 19:34:40
阅读次数:
226
栈和队列是两种应用非常广泛的数据结构,它们都来自线性表数据结构,都是“操作受限”的线性表。 栈的概念 栈(Stack):是限制在表的一端进行插入和删除操作的线性表。又称为后进先出LIFO (Last In First Out)或先进后出FILO (First In Last Out)线性表。 栈顶( ...
分类:
其他好文 时间:
2018-07-14 10:27:01
阅读次数:
164
Go语言开发(七)、Go语言错误处理一、defer延迟函数1、defer延迟函数简介defer在声明时不会立即执行,而是在函数return后,再按照FILO(先进后出)的原则依次执行每一个defer,一般用于异常处理、释放资源、清理数据、记录日志等。每次defer语句执行时,defer修饰的函数的返回值和参数取值会照常进行计算和保存,但是defer修饰的函数不会执行。等到上一级函数返回前,会按照d
分类:
编程语言 时间:
2018-06-19 20:41:37
阅读次数:
2529
概要学完Vector了之后,接下来我们开始学习Stack。Stack很简单,它继承于Vector。学习方式还是和之前一样,先对Stack有个整体认识,然后再学习它的源码;最后再通过实例来学会使用它。第1部分Stack介绍Stack简介Stack是栈。它的特性是:先进后出(FILO,FirstInLastOut)。java工具包中的Stack是继承于Vector(矢量队列)的,由于Vector是通过
分类:
编程语言 时间:
2018-05-17 11:50:15
阅读次数:
183
一、栈的特点 1、栈是一种先进后出(FILO)的数据结构 2、栈的增删操作只能从栈顶操作 二、栈有如下三种操作 push -- 将元素压入栈中(向栈顶添加元素):先修改指针,再增加元素 peek -- 返回栈顶元素。pop -- 弹出栈中元素(返回并删除栈顶元素):先增加元素,再修改指针 三、自定义 ...
分类:
编程语言 时间:
2018-05-13 15:37:57
阅读次数:
183
栈:FILO 其实就是一端增加和一端删除的链表 一般我们对头进行增加和删除 几个必要函数:1.Init 2.Push 3.Pop 4.Clear 5.Destroy 6.GetTop 7.GetCount 8.IsEmpty 怎样销毁栈? 销毁后不能进行Push 和Pop 1.设置标志,执行销毁函数 ...
分类:
其他好文 时间:
2018-05-09 15:11:38
阅读次数:
178